A Year of Growth and Impact:

  • New Initiatives: We embarked on several exciting new projects this year, including “Sustainability in the Textile Value Chain” – a crucial step towards minimizing our environmental footprint. “Waste to Wealth” initiative explored innovative ways to utilize textile waste, transforming it into valuable resources.
  • Key Partnerships: We forged valuable partnerships with esteemed organizations such as FSSAI, NMMC, the Textile Ministry of India, SBI Foundation, SAMHITA, and NABARD, expanding our reach and impact.
  • Empowering Women: The Women Health & Livelihood Alliance (WHOLA) continued to empower women artisans through health awareness initiatives.
  • Celebrating Artisans: Tisser actively participated in numerous exhibitions, showcasing the exceptional talent and creativity of our artisans.

A Year of Recognition and Innovation:

  • Industry Recognition: We were honored to be a part of the DEIA Catalyst Program, a significant step towards fostering diversity, equity, inclusion, and accessibility within our organization.
  • Celebrating Women: We commemorated Women’s Day with a special event at the WTC, Mumbai, and celebrated the achievements of women entrepreneurs through “Sutradhar” – a platform for felicitating them with Zep Udyoginchi and the MSME wing.
  • Promoting Indian Arts: We showcased the beauty of Indian arts in contemporary interior designs through “Desh Ki Khoj” at ACETECH 2024 and other platforms, inspiring a new generation of design enthusiasts.
  • Digital Empowerment: We launched “Kalashala” – a comprehensive digital learning tool designed to empower artisans with the skills and knowledge they need to thrive in the modern market. This initiative aligns with our #crafttech vision, bridging the gap between traditional crafts and digital technologies.
